    In Master (A) PC (192.168.1.20) open command prompt and type:
    net use K: "\\192.168.1.22\Desktop-JSFP1GJ"

    Wait for the response
    It should ask
    1. for a user name (user that is logged in Server C)
    2. password

    Are you sure that the sharename is correct?
    Permission
    Everyone
    Full Control

    Not the PC-Name!!
    I mean Share-Name!!
    Rightclick on the folder Properties/Sharing/advanced sharing/sharename...

    The PC-Name looks like the default random name

    Then substitute in the above net use command the computer name with the new sharename

    Having done a litle more testing - now that my memory about Net Use has been jogged :)

    I can confirm that when the C: drive on the Server is mapped as K:, both in the CMD window and in File Manager I am able to display the Files and folders and access most of then - there are naturally some which have restricted access and I can live with that.

    After I had deleted the mapping, I then used \\192.168.1.22\c in the file manager and could also 'see' the whole of Server/C: - and navigate it !! I do consider that as a result - of sorts - . . . . . .

    Ahem ! - - - - I've now realised that I had swapped the two IP addresses - not that it matters a jot, because I've been sucessfull with .22 & .24 and it's actually shown that I can access both the Server and the Slave from the Master.

    File Manager still shows the 'mapped' drive but I assume that will vanish with a re-boot (which I'm loath to do at the moment since I might lose remote access)

    I'm still getting "Cannot access . . . " when using \\Desktop-EKI902T or \\Desktop-JSFP1GJ though but it does take some time for the error message to appear - whereas it used to be 'instant' , and the [diagnose] always returns "can't find the problem" - - and there are no icons in the [Network] Folder.
